Twentynine Palms, Ca– Residents of Twentynine Palms are invited to participate in a public meeting on Thursday, September 30, to provide feedback on the City’s proposed branding and marketing program. The public meeting will begin at 6:30 p.m. at the Twentynine Palms Community Services Center across from Luckie Park, 74325 Joe Davis Drive.
City staff and principals from the consulting firm RSG Inc. will discuss the results of a 2009 branding and marketing program study and preliminary options that were presented to the City Council in March 2010 and will offer an additional opportunity for community input.
The goal for creating a new branding logo and marketing tagline is to establish an image for Twentynine Palms that encompasses all the assets the community offers, such as the beauty of the natural desert, a strong sense of community, the Marine Corps Air Ground Combat Center, Joshua Tree National Park, public murals, a vibrant art community, and the opportunity for outdoor activities.
